    What will the upgrade entail? Any chance of ever seeing a radar installed? Throwing a small radar in the nose and getting something like the Derby/R-Darter might make them feel a little better about the delays in the F-X program.

    As A-29 said, the radar will be SCP-01, an air-to-ground device. The nature of the airframe (slow, high drag, underpowered) seems to drive ideas away from anything that resembles air-to-air. Hence, the delays in the FX program can be compensated by the F-5M, but hardly by A-1M.
